The global cryptocurrency market cap now stands at $2.19T, down by -0.55% over the last day, according to CoinMarketCap data.
Bitcoin (BTC) has been trading between $62,501 and $64,425 over the past 24 hours. As of 09:30 AM (UTC) today, BTC is trading at $63,112, down by -1.12%.
Most major cryptocurrencies by market cap are trading mixed. Market outperformers include DCR, XEC, and KITE, up by 46%, 28%, and 24%, respectively.
